What the data includes

The dataset for Vilafranca del Penedès contains a single monitoring location – the sports‑zone station – and provides readings for five pollutants: nitrogen monoxide (NO), nitrogen dioxide (NO₂), total nitrogen oxides (NOX), ozone (O₃) and particulate matter 10 µm or smaller (PM10). All measurements are expressed in micrograms per cubic metre (µg/m³) and were last updated on 2026‑02‑10 at 03:00 UTC, meaning the most recent data are less than a week old.

Across the five pollutants the recorded values show no variation within each series. NO is consistently reported as 1.0 µg/m³, NO₂ as 9.0 µg/m³, NOX as 10.0 µg/m³, O₃ as 29.0 µg/m³ and PM10 also as 9.0 µg/m³; the minimum, median, maximum, 10th percentile and 90th percentile are identical for each parameter. This uniformity indicates that only a single snapshot is currently available rather than a range of observations over time.

Because the city’s air‑quality picture relies on just one station, spatial coverage is limited to the immediate vicinity of the sports zone. While the data are fresh, the lack of multiple rows or older records means that temporal trends and variations across different neighbourhoods cannot be assessed from this dataset alone. Users should keep in mind that conditions elsewhere in Vilafranca del Penedès may differ from those captured at this single point in time.
